This game was a cornerstone of my childhood. A weird, alien world that you're basically tossed into and told "go" from the beginning. Everywhere you walk is fraught with danger and potential death, the world is also quite unforgiving (at first).

I've tried at least once a year for 14 years to actually beat Morrowind (hours on steam don't include the endless hours using the original discs), and never have completed the main story. Each time I boot it up I tell myself "this is the year" and I end up burning hours meandering the massive and beautiful world, getting completely lost.

If you've played Skyrim or maybe Oblivion and are hungry for more, I would wholeheartedly recommend Morrowind. Yes, it's crusty, but I think it holds up. With some mods it works even better (or check out OpenMW). The questlines are well done, the story is fantastic, and the character build options are endless!

It breaks my heart to give this a thumbs down, but I will hold it until things change. The game is genuinely fun, I really enjoy many aspects of it but the bugs are so dreadful you just end up wasting so much time. The center aspect of this game is marriage, children, all the family stuff. The dates are constantly bugged, with your date hovering in the date spot for days, accepting endless gifts with no benefit. The marriage questline is the most confounding and frustrating chore in this game, and there's moments you can just fail the whole thing and have to start again, mind you the marriage questline takes about 7 days to fully complete. It requires you at one point to pick a certain weed, but if you, like most scouted the maps and picked them, you're SOL, and will fail the quest, losing a heart, which requires you to wait until the 'sunday' to pick the marriage rose but OH ALSO you have to get the hearts back to max or they'll just deny the rose that re-starts the questline.

I really do quite like the game, well right now the IDEA of the game. In this current state I cannot recommend anyone investing time, because I've lost so many hours I won't get back due to either bugs or just a poorly thought out system.

I have well over 75 hours on the Playstation 4 version, but was so beyond hyped to be able to purchase it again for PC. I'm in no way a diehard Kojima fan, frankly I think he's overrated, but this game is honestly a hidden gem. A lot of people brushed it off when they saw "walking simulator" and I think a lot of them are missing out.

Is this game for everyone? No. Does it break the mold on traditional AAA games that just copy/paste the same thing with some changes (looking at you Ubisoft)? Yeah it does, and it does it well. Is it perfect? No.

It's a unique story that no one except Kojima would create, but it's interesting, touching, and worth experiencing. Experiencing the landscape while helping to reunite a bunch of closed of settlements while these creatures from beyond, the BT's are waiting to get their hands on you, and if they're not after you a bunch of deliverers-gone-mad known as MULEs will try to tase you and steal your ♥♥♥♥.

Seriously though, it's a unique experience and absolutely worth it. I bought it, bought the Collector's Edition, then bought it a third time on PC (hoping for mods). If you're thinking about getting it, play it through to Chapter 2 before you brush it off and scream refund from the rooftops.

I never thought I would find myself playing a truck simulator...

But here we are. It's oddly relaxing and fun to pick up a delivery, and zoom across Europe enjoying the sites, listening to some awesome music (they have built-in radio stations for you to enjoy, and a multitude of languages), and try not to get a ticket for speeding or smashing into things.

The controls and steering of the truck take a bit to get used to, at this point I come as close to driving straight across a traffic circle as I can with it being "legal" and not causing damage to my delivery. Definitely worth a try if you enjoy simulators.
